sufficient

/səˈfɪʃənt/suf·FI·cient

Band 5-6task2task1speaking

enough for a particular purpose or need

Examples

For Task 1, you need sufficient data to describe trends clearly.

I didn’t have sufficient evidence to support my claim during the exam.

Make sure you have sufficient time to plan before you start writing Task 2.

Band 8 sentence

The research presented sufficient quantitative evidence to draw meaningful conclusions about migration patterns.

Collocations

  • sufficient evidence
  • sufficient time
  • sufficient resources

Word family

suffice verbsufficiency noun
